Asheville, North Carolina, nestled in the heart of the Blue Ridge Mountains, is renowned for its vibrant arts scene, craft breweries, and breathtaking natural beauty. But beyond its well-deserved reputation as a haven for artists and outdoor enthusiasts, Asheville boasts a burgeoning culinary landscape that is quickly attracting national attention. And at the forefront of this delicious revolution? A diverse and delicious array of Mexican restaurants, each offering a unique taste of south-of-the-border flavors. Have you ever wondered where the best Mexican food in Asheville, NC is?
From authentic family-run taquerias to innovative fusion spots pushing culinary boundaries, Asheville’s Mexican food scene has something to satisfy every craving. Forget bland chain restaurants; we’re talking about fresh, locally-sourced ingredients, handcrafted salsas, and recipes passed down through generations. This isn’t just about burritos and tacos; it’s about experiencing the rich culture and vibrant flavors of Mexico, right here in the mountains of North Carolina. This guide will navigate you through the must-try destinations, ensuring a fiesta of flavors with every bite.
What Makes a Mexican Restaurant the Best in Asheville?
Before we dive into the delicious details, it’s important to understand what qualities elevated these restaurants to the top of our list. It’s not just about the taste (though that’s obviously a major factor!). It’s a combination of elements that create a truly memorable dining experience.
First and foremost, authenticity plays a crucial role. We looked for restaurants that honored traditional Mexican culinary techniques and ingredients, whether it was slow-cooked carnitas, handmade tortillas, or complex mole sauces. The use of high-quality, fresh ingredients was another key factor. Restaurants that prioritize sourcing locally whenever possible, from produce to meats, consistently delivered superior flavor and freshness.
Menu variety was also important. While we appreciate a simple, focused menu done well, we also wanted to highlight restaurants that offered a diverse range of options, catering to different tastes and dietary needs. This includes vegetarian and vegan options, as well as dishes that showcase regional specialties from different parts of Mexico.
Customer reviews were carefully considered. We scoured online platforms, read countless testimonials, and factored in the overall consensus of diners who have experienced these restaurants firsthand. Positive reviews consistently mentioned exceptional food quality, friendly service, and a welcoming atmosphere.
Speaking of atmosphere, the ambiance of a restaurant can significantly impact the dining experience. We looked for places with a vibrant and inviting atmosphere, whether it was a bustling cantina with live music or a cozy family-run eatery with colorful décor.
Finally, value for money was taken into account. We wanted to ensure that the restaurants on our list offered a fair price point for the quality and quantity of food provided. A great meal shouldn’t break the bank!
Exploring the Culinary Gems
Nine Mile: A Caribbean Infusion with a Mexican Flair
While not strictly Mexican, Nine Mile deserves a spot on this list for its unique and flavorful dishes that draw inspiration from both Caribbean and Mexican cuisine. Known for its vibrant atmosphere and creative menu, Nine Mile is a favorite among locals and tourists alike. The restaurant is a haven for vegetarians and carnivores, and the menu offers many vegan choices.
The atmosphere is casual and lively, with colorful artwork adorning the walls and a constant buzz of conversation. Expect a wait, especially during peak hours, but the delicious food is well worth it.
A must-try dish is the Rasta Pasta, a creamy coconut milk-based pasta with jerk chicken or tofu. Also, the restaurant serves a selection of rice bowls and is sure to have a flavor that you love! The prices are reasonable, making it an accessible option for a casual meal. Nine Mile’s location is located at three different locations, but you can visit them at Merrimon Avenue.
“Nine Mile is always a hit! The food is consistently delicious, and the atmosphere is so much fun. I highly recommend the Rasta Pasta!” – Yelp Reviewer
Tupelo Honey: Southern Charm Meets Mexican Spice
Tupelo Honey Southern Kitchen & Bar, a beloved Asheville institution, adds a touch of Southern charm to its Mexican-inspired dishes. Known for its innovative twists on classic Southern comfort food, Tupelo Honey also offers a selection of flavorful and satisfying Mexican-inspired options.
The restaurant boasts a warm and inviting atmosphere, with rustic décor and friendly service. It’s a great spot for a casual brunch, lunch, or dinner.
Don’t miss the Shrimp and Grits, a Southern staple with a Mexican twist. Also, the tacos are a hit amongst many visitors. While the menu features many great dishes, be sure to try the banana pudding! Prices are on the higher side, but the quality of the food and service makes it worth the splurge. Visit them at College Street.
“Tupelo Honey is a must-visit in Asheville! Their Shrimp and Grits is incredible, and their other Mexican-inspired dishes are equally delicious.” – Google Reviewer
White Duck Taco Shop: A Taco Lover’s Paradise
For taco aficionados, White Duck Taco Shop is a must-visit destination. With multiple locations throughout Asheville, this popular eatery offers a diverse and creative selection of tacos, each packed with flavor and unique ingredients. Known for its laid-back atmosphere and affordable prices, White Duck Taco Shop is a favorite among locals and tourists alike.
The atmosphere is casual and lively, with communal tables and a vibrant energy. Expect a wait, especially during peak hours, but the delicious tacos are well worth it.
With locations all over Asheville, they make sure to cater to the masses! The Fish Taco is a must-try, featuring crispy fried fish, slaw, and a tangy sauce. Also, don’t skip out on the sides, such as rice and beans. The prices are reasonable, making it an accessible option for a quick and satisfying meal. Their location is located at Riverside Drive.
“White Duck Taco Shop is my go-to spot for tacos in Asheville! They have so many unique and delicious options, and the prices are great.” – TripAdvisor Reviewer
Salsa’s: Authentic Flavors with a Caribbean Influence
Salsa’s on Patton Avenue brings the vibrant flavors of Mexico and the Caribbean together in a unique and exciting culinary experience. Known for its fresh ingredients, bold spices, and creative dishes, Salsa’s is a long-time favorite among Asheville locals and tourists alike.
The restaurant boasts a colorful and lively atmosphere, with Mexican art adorning the walls and a constant buzz of conversation.
A must-try dish is the Queso Fundido, a melted cheese dip with chorizo and poblano peppers. Also, make sure to try the plantains, which is a sweet side to a savory dish. The prices are moderate, making it a great option for a special occasion or a casual night out.
“Salsa’s is a hidden gem in Asheville! Their food is so flavorful and authentic, and the atmosphere is always festive.” – Yelp Reviewer
More Delicious Options: A Few Honorable Mentions
Asheville’s Mexican food scene is so rich and diverse that it’s impossible to include every great restaurant on our main list. Here are a few honorable mentions that are definitely worth checking out:
- Taqueria Muñoz: A small, no-frills spot serving up authentic Mexican tacos and tortas at incredibly affordable prices.
- Modesto: Authentic Mexican Cuisine, Modesto is known for it’s great food and quick service.
- Sierra Nevada Taproom Restaurant: While known for it’s great beer, Sierra Nevada has a lot of great Mexican food items on the menu!
Tips for Savoring Asheville’s Mexican Delights
To make the most of your Mexican food adventure in Asheville, here are a few helpful tips:
- Plan Ahead: Many of the most popular Mexican restaurants in Asheville can get quite busy, especially on weekends. Consider making reservations in advance, if possible, or be prepared for a potential wait.
- Embrace the Wait: If you do encounter a wait, don’t despair! Use the time to explore the surrounding neighborhood, grab a drink at a nearby brewery, or simply soak in the atmosphere of Asheville.
- Explore the Beer Scene: Asheville is known for its thriving craft beer scene. Pair your Mexican meal with a local brew for the ultimate Asheville experience. Many restaurants offer a wide selection of local beers on tap.
- Step Outside Your Comfort Zone: Don’t be afraid to try something new and adventurous. Ask your server for recommendations, or explore the menu for dishes you’ve never tried before.
- Happy Hour Hunting: Check for happy hour specials. Many Mexican restaurants offer discounted drinks and appetizers during happy hour, making it a great way to sample a variety of flavors without breaking the bank.
The Sizzling Conclusion
Asheville, North Carolina, has emerged as a culinary destination, and its Mexican food scene is a testament to the city’s diverse and innovative spirit. From authentic family-run taquerias to creative fusion spots, Asheville offers a taste of Mexico that is both delicious and unforgettable. Whether you’re craving traditional tacos, flavorful enchiladas, or innovative dishes that push culinary boundaries, you’re sure to find something to satisfy your cravings in Asheville. So, grab your appetite and get ready to embark on a culinary adventure. What are your favorite Mexican spots in Asheville? Share them in the comments below!